Segment Control
This is the “raw” interface. Each segment of the display can be controled independently. The segments are “active-low”, e.g. the segment is on if a logical “0” is written to it.
Programming Example
The code snippet bellow shows how to use the 7 segment display in segment control mode.
#include "reg_ctboard.h" CT_SEG7->RAW.BYTE.DS0 = (uint8_t) data_byte; /* Write byte of segment data to DS0. */ CT_SEG7->RAW.HWORD.DS3_2 = (uint16_t) data_halfword; /* Write half word of segment data to DS3..2. */ CT_SEG7->RAW.WORD = (uint32_t) data_word; /* Write word of segment data to all displays. */
ADDR_SEG7_RAW EQU 0x60000110 LDR r0, =ADDR_SEG7_RAW STRB r1, [r0, #0] ; Write byte of segment data to DS0. STRH r1, [r0, #2] ; Write half word of segment data to DS3..2. STR r1, [r0, #0] ; Write word of segment data to all displays.
